At the facility station, an electrical generator converts mechanical electrical power into a set of three AC electric currents, one particular from Every coil (or winding) with the generator. The windings are organized such the currents are at precisely the same frequency but While using the peaks and troughs in their wave types offset to provide three complementary currents having a phase separation of one-third cycle (one hundred twenty° or twoπ⁄three radians). The generator frequency is usually 50 or sixty Hz, dependant upon the nation.

A result of the phase difference, the voltage on any conductor reaches its peak at just one 3rd of a cycle source immediately after among the list of other conductors and a person third of the cycle before the remaining conductor. This phase hold off provides regular ability transfer to the well balanced linear load. Furthermore, it makes it attainable to provide a rotating magnetic subject in An electrical motor and produce other phase arrangements using transformers (As an illustration, a two-phase method utilizing a Scott-T transformer).
